To be honest, size is way less critical with double boots than singles... you can get away with being a euro size too big quite happily:
- You you'll likely be doing less techy climbing with them than your Guides, and thus less fine control needed
- You'll not be doing long walk ins or approaches in them, like you might with the Guides
- Extra volume can be filled with thicker socks as it just gives more warmth
- You can adjust/thermo fit your foam inners
- If you add laces to the foam inners (I highly recommend if the model year inners have the loops), then you can dial the fit even more
